[发明专利]遥控器功能选择的实现方法及遥控器无效
申请号: | 201010144432.1 | 申请日: | 2010-04-12 |
公开(公告)号: | CN102214389A | 公开(公告)日: | 2011-10-12 |
发明(设计)人: | 娄喜才;毛艳萍 | 申请(专利权)人: | 海尔集团公司;青岛海尔智能电子有限公司 |
主分类号: | G08C17/02 | 分类号: | G08C17/02;G08C23/04 |
代理公司: | 北京中博世达专利商标代理有限公司 11274 | 代理人: | 申健 |
地址: | 266101 山东省青*** | 国省代码: | 山东;37 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 遥控器 功能 选择 实现 方法 | ||
1.一种遥控器功能选择的实现方法,其特征在于,包括:
确定遥控器的已知功能集合对应的跳线数据集合;
将所述跳线数据集合写入所述遥控器的特定存储空间中,所述跳线数据集合由所述遥控器的主程序调用;
根据所述跳线数据集合对所述遥控器进行功能初始化,使得所述遥控器上的每个按键实现各自关联的跳线数据对应的功能。
2.根据权利要求1所述的遥控器功能选择的实现方法,其特征在于,还包括:预定义的功能集合、预定义的跳线数据集合和预设功能-跳线对应规则;
所述特定存储空间为M字节时,所述预定义功能集合中包括N个功能,所述第n个功能表示为F(n),其中,F(n)的取值范围为N=8*M,N≥n≥1,N≥Xn≥1;
所述预定义跳线数据集合中包括N个跳线数据,所述第n个跳线数据表示为A(n),其中,A(n)的取值范围为{0,1,2,...2Xn-1},N=8*M,N≥n≥1,N≥Xn≥1;
所述预设功能-跳线对应规则包括:所述第n个功能的取值范围中的第j个功能与所述第n个跳线数据的取值范围{0,1,2,...2Xn-1}中的第j个数据对应,其中,2Xn≥j≥1。
3.根据权利要求2所述的遥控器功能选择的实现方法,其特征在于,
所述确定遥控器的已知功能集合对应的跳线数据集合为:根据预设功能-跳线对应规则确定已知遥控器的功能集合对应的跳线数据集合,
所述遥控器的已知功能集合中的第n个功能的取值为所述预定义功能集合中第n个功能的取值范围中的第j个功能;所述确定的跳线数据集合中的第n个跳线数据的取值为所述预定义跳线数据集合中第n个跳线数据的取值范围{0,1,2,...2Xn-1}中的第j个数据,其中,2Xn≥j≥1。
4.根据权利要求1所述的遥控器功能选择的实现方法,其特征在于,将所述跳线数据集合写入所述遥控器的特定存储空间中包括:
在写入主程序的同时,将所述跳线数据集合写入所述遥控器的特定存储空间中;或者
在主程序已写入时,将所述跳线数据集合通过预设跳线写入器写入所述遥控器的特定存储空间中;或者
在主程序已写入时,将所述跳线数据集合通过预设的跳线编辑方式使用遥控器键盘写入所述遥控器的特定存储空间中。
5.根据权利要求1所述的遥控器功能选择的实现方法,其特征在于,根据所述跳线数据集合对所述遥控器进行功能初始化包括:
依次读取所述跳线数据集合中的每个跳线数据,所述跳线数据与所述遥控器上的按键一一关联;
根据预设功能-跳线对应规则确定每个跳线数据对应的功能;
将所述功能初始化为对应的功能模块。
6.一种遥控器,其特征在于,所述遥控器上配置有跳线数据集合和调用所述跳线数据集合的主程序;
所述遥控器上的按键与所述跳线数据一一关联,所述每一个跳线数据对应一个功能模块。
7.根据权利要求6所述的遥控器,其特征在于,所述遥控器的每个功能对应独立的功能模块。
8.一种遥控器功能选择的执行方法,其特征在于,包括:
接收按键信号;
从跳线数据集合中读取所述按键信号对应的跳线数据;
执行所述跳线数据对应的功能模块。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于海尔集团公司;青岛海尔智能电子有限公司,未经海尔集团公司;青岛海尔智能电子有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201010144432.1/1.html,转载请声明来源钻瓜专利网。